7#include <aws/qconnect/QConnect_EXPORTS.h>
39 m_beginOffsetInclusiveHasBeenSet =
true;
40 m_beginOffsetInclusive = value;
55 m_endOffsetExclusiveHasBeenSet =
true;
56 m_endOffsetExclusive = value;
64 int m_beginOffsetInclusive{0};
66 int m_endOffsetExclusive{0};
67 bool m_beginOffsetInclusiveHasBeenSet =
false;
68 bool m_endOffsetExclusiveHasBeenSet =
false;
CitationSpan & WithEndOffsetExclusive(int value)
int GetBeginOffsetInclusive() const
AWS_QCONNECT_API CitationSpan()=default
bool EndOffsetExclusiveHasBeenSet() const
int GetEndOffsetExclusive() const
AWS_QCONNECT_API CitationSpan & operator=(Aws::Utils::Json::JsonView jsonValue)
bool BeginOffsetInclusiveHasBeenSet() const
void SetBeginOffsetInclusive(int value)
AWS_QCONNECT_API Aws::Utils::Json::JsonValue Jsonize() const
AWS_QCONNECT_API CitationSpan(Aws::Utils::Json::JsonView jsonValue)
void SetEndOffsetExclusive(int value)
CitationSpan & WithBeginOffsetInclusive(int value)
Aws::Utils::Json::JsonValue JsonValue